建筑业高投入、高消耗、高排放和低效率的粗放式发展方式给经济社会造成了巨大的隐患,装配式建筑能够促进人、自然与建筑之间的协调发展.为全面洞悉装配式农宅节能领域的研究动态,填补装配式农宅节能的研究空白,基于中英文共计264篇装配式农宅节能领域的研究文献,运用CiteSpace文献计量与可视化方法,绘制主要机构和作者知识图谱、关键词和研究热点知识图谱、突发主题知识图谱,从关键机构作者、研究热点、研究演进三个维度对国内外装配式农宅节能研究领域文献进行研究分析.
